Senior IT Project Manager - Sales

Summary

The Senior IT Project Manager will oversee 3-5 small- to medium-scale Sales technology projects, managing project plans, budgets, and cross-functional teams. The role requires expertise in project management methodologies like Agile and Waterfall, proficiency in tools like Jira and Smartsheet, and strong communication skills in both English and Spanish.

We are currently searching for a Senior IT Project Manager - Sales:

Responsibilities

  • Manage 3-5 small- to medium-scale Sales technology projects from planning to completion.
  • Facilitate working sessions, build and maintain project plans, manage schedules and resource forecasts, track deliverables, and escalate issues with clear recommendations.
  • Partner with Sales, Marketing, Pricing, Finance, IT, vendor, and field stakeholders to clarify scope, success metrics, dependencies, adoption needs, and decision points.
  • Translate business needs into actionable delivery plans and keep technical and non-technical audiences aligned.
  • Manage project financials by building forecasts, tracking actuals, validating budget assumptions, documenting cost drivers, and communicating budget impacts or tradeoffs to leadership.
  • Coordinate the work of assigned project resources by requesting support, clarifying roles, facilitating team meetings, following up on action items, and providing feedback on delivery quality.
  • Manage risks, issues, assumptions, and dependencies by identifying trigger events, documenting mitigation plans, and supporting contingency planning.
  • Support vendor oversight for Sales technology initiatives by tracking contractual deliverables, coordinating vendor timelines, and supporting RFI/RFP activities.
  • Adhere to enterprise project management practices by maintaining project artifacts, tracking key metrics, supporting governance routines, and capturing lessons learned for the PMO.
  • Provide hands-on project support when needed, including coordinating data validation, adoption readiness, training materials, rollout logistics, and reporting.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in Business Administration, Computer Science, Management Information Systems, or a related field.
  • 5+ years of project management experience, including IT or related business experience.
  • Experience working with project life cycle methodologies, including waterfall, agile, hybrid, and product/wave-based delivery models.
  • Experience influencing and managing cross-functional project teams without formal direct reporting relationships.
  • Knowledge of PMI-based project management competency areas and experience applying these methods to deliver successful projects.
  • Strong analytical skills required to manage budgeting, forecasting, risk management, process management, quality control, and reporting.
  • Strong oral and written communication skills with the ability to interact across all levels of management and translate between business and technical audiences.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office products, particularly Excel, PowerPoint, Word, Visio, SharePoint, Teams.
  • Proficiency in project management tools such as Smartsheet and Jira.
  • High-Performance Mindset: Resilience, emotional intelligence, and a focus on agile delivery.
  • Technologist DNA: A deep understanding of the difference between "coding" and "engineering."

Desired

  • 3+ years supporting projects in Sales, Marketing, Pricing, CRM, customer experience, order-to-cash, field enablement, distribution, manufacturing, or commercial technology environments.
  • Experience with Sales or commercial platforms such as Salesforce or CRM applications, pricing tools, customer analytics, marketing automation, ERP integrations, order management, reporting tools, or field technology.
  • PMI Certified associate in project management (CAPM) or Project Management Professional (PMP) certification.
  • Familiarity with cloud-native foundations or AI coding assistants.

Languages

  • Advanced Oral English.
  • Advanced Spanish.
